it went from bad to worse penn state After losing in week 7 Northwestern 22-21 On Saturday. And if the on-field defeat wasn’t enough, Nittany Lions coach James Franklin became the subject of the Wildcats’ petty trolls.
After a surprise loss to Unranked UCLA In Week 6, the pressure was on for Franklin to deliver a win against Northwestern. Instead, Penn State lost its third straight game after scoring just one touchdown in the second half.
Northwestern targeted Franklin with its postgame troll. on friday, franklin posted a video on x With the caption: “North-Western, North-Western, North-Western!!!”
The Wildcats referenced that caption, instead emphasizing the last Northwestern in all capital letters to clinch the win.

Texas 23, Oklahoma 6
Rivalries often bring out the best from teams on the field. The same can be said about trolling. texas beat number 6 oklahoma 23-6 (Allstate) in the Red River Rivalry game. The Longhorns’ defense allowed only 258 yards passing and intercepted three passes from the Sooners’ quarterback. john matertexas quarterback arch manning Throwed for 166 yards and a score.
This big win came from a small post up for the Longhorns. Texas references the lyrics of the song “Ain’t No Love in Oklahoma” and Red River’s Golden Hat trophy.

Alabama 27, Missouri 24
Few things in college football feel as enjoyable as getting a big win in conference play, which is something alabama quite familiar since 27-24 win on week 7 missouriCrimson Tide quarterback ty simpson Completed 23 of 31 for 200 yards and 3 passing touchdowns, including a 1-yard strike to running back Daniel Hill Alabama was late by two points on fourth down.
Something that might have made the post-game a little sweeter for Alabama fans on Saturday? A subtle social media troll sent by the Crimson Tide after the win takes a simple but effective shot at Missouri’s primary color.

Bowling Green 28, Toledo 23
bowling Green Lost 21-0 to local rivals early on toledo But he eventually held his own and scored four unanswered touchdowns in one 28-23 win. running back cameron pettaway Two of these touchdowns were scored during big games. He caught only two passes in the contest, but both went for scores of 45 and 73 yards, respectively.
After the game, Bowling Green trolled its rival with a video of the team waving the trophy on the field, using certain specific words and capitalization.

South Florida 63, North Texas 36
One of the biggest Group of 5 games of the season turned into a loss after halftime south florida Scored 42 points during the final 30 minutes of the contest. Dual-threat Bulls quarterback Byram Brown As dynamic as ever, he threw for 245 yards and three touchdowns in addition to rushing for 82 yards and two scores. 63-36 win.
After the game, a troll was ready in South Florida North Texas The hosts posted a graphic showing Rocky the Bull riding a horse in cowboy attire with the caption “Everything is bigger in Texas.”

Colorado State 49, Fresno State 21
Colorado State Snapped a three-game losing streak and found his top form on Friday night, scoring 35 points in the first half. 49-21 win against fresno stateAnd although the margin of victory was gaudy, Colorado State’s defense also made a lot of plays – forcing four Fresno State turnovers, including a 36-yard fumble recovery touchdown.
The Rams’ social media team trolled the Bulldogs after the game, referencing Fresno State’s mascot with the caption “Sit. Stay. Roll Over” and a graphic showing an “L” attached to the dog’s collar.
